Simulink Block 内部変数の取り出し

お世話になっております。
SimulinkのBlock内の内部変数、例えばパラメータ設定の変数を取り出し、他のBlock、Subsystemで利用する方法をご教示ください。

5 件のコメント

Atsushi Ueno
Atsushi Ueno 2022 年 2 月 16 日
>ブロック パラメーター値にプログラムからアクセスするには、関数 get_param および set_param を使用します。
質問の意味を色々な意味に捉える事が出来てしまいます。これで目的の事が実現できますか?不明点があれば追記願います。
勇二 橋本
勇二 橋本 2022 年 2 月 17 日
内容説明が足らずすみませんでした。
実施したいのは以下です。
Table LookUpした結果をCal‗Dat(N)に保存し(NはLoop処理の反復回数を入れます)、他のLogicで計算に使用します。
Cal‗Dat(N)へのデータ格納は、MATLAB Functionで実施するのですが、このMATLAB Functionで設定したCal‗Dat(N)を、他のLogicで参照する方法をご教示していただきたいです。
勇二 橋本
勇二 橋本 2022 年 2 月 17 日
なお、Cal‗Dat(N)はパラメータに指定しております。
Atsushi Ueno
Atsushi Ueno 2022 年 2 月 23 日
申し訳ないですが、言葉だといまいち状況が把握できません。
勇二 橋本
勇二 橋本 2022 年 2 月 24 日
説明が足らず、たびたび申し訳ありません。添付の様なModelを検討しているのですが、最後の計算結果をBaseWorkSpace変数の上書きが出来ないものかと思い、質問させていただきました。よろしくお願いいたします。

サインインしてコメントする。

回答 (0 件)

カテゴリ

ヘルプ センター および File Exchangeモデル、ブロックおよび端子のコールバック についてさらに検索

質問済み:

2022 年 2 月 16 日

コメント済み:

2022 年 2 月 24 日

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!